Git是一个分布式版本控制系统,用于跟踪和管理软件开发项目的变化。下面是一些基本的Git操作:
1. 初始化仓库:
- `git init`:在当前目录初始化一个新的Git仓库。
2. 克隆仓库:
- `git clone <仓库地址>`:从远程仓库克隆一个本地仓库。
3. 添加和提交文件:
- `git add <文件名>`:将文件添加到暂存区。
- `git add .`:将所有修改的文件添加到暂存区。
- `git commit -m "提交信息"`:将暂存区的文件提交到本地仓库。
4. 查看状态和历史:
- `git status`:查看当前文件的状态。
- `git log`:查看提交历史记录。
5. 分支操作:
- `git branch`:列出所有分支。
- `git branch <分支名>`:创建一个新分支。
- `git checkout <分支名>`:切换到指定分支。
- `git merge <分支名>`:将指定分支的更改合并到当前分支。
6. 远程仓库:
- `git remote add origin <远程仓库地址>`:将本地仓库关联到远程仓库。
- `git push origin <分支名>`:将本地分支推送到远程仓库。
- `git pull origin <分支名>`:从远程仓库拉取更新到本地分支。
7. 撤销和回退:
- `git checkout -- <文件名>`:撤销对文件的修改。
- `git reset HEAD <文件名>`:将文件移出暂存区。
- `git revert <提交ID>`:撤销指定的提交。
当你想要从现有的远程仓库中获取一份代码,可以按照如下流程
首先克隆到本地仓库
git clone your ssh
然后进行修改,add和commit
git add filename
git commit -m"change"
如果你想要将自己的修改推送到远程仓库中
git push origin master
注意,有些版本使用main作为主分支,你需要确认你的远程仓库采用的是master还是main
如果main则是
git push origin main
这只是一些基本的Git操作,还有更多高级的操作和命令可以用于更复杂的开发流程和团队协作。Git拥有强大的版本控制功能,能够有效地管理项目的变化,并支持多人协同开发。